Kitsap County Office of Public Defense Seeks PUBLIC DEFENDER 1
June 29, 2023 | Alison Pagan

Kitsap County’s Office of Public Defense is staffed with dedicated attorneys focused on providing client-centered representation to every individual they  represent.We have an exciting opportunity for an Attorney to join our team! 

In the Attorney 1 classification, the incumbent provides representation to indigent defendants accused of misdemeanor and gross misdemeanor crimes in municipal and district courts in Kitsap County with moderate supervision from a more experienced public defender.

The ideal candidate will have general knowledge of:   Courts of limited jurisdiction and general criminal law and procedure and trial practice. Legal research methods and materials, including computerized legal research. Structure and operations of local government and its relationship to other levels of government and other public agencies.

The ideal candidate will have the ability to:  Communicate clearly, both orally and in writing. Gather, organize and analyze facts and the law on an issue, or in a case, and present the case in the appropriate forum. Work independently as well as part of a team. Demonstrate self-motivation and initiative. Establish and maintain constructive working relationships. Utilize a personal computer and related software packages to perform word processing, analysis, information retrieval and tracking. Have a strong sense of ethics.
